CM-CF 60V Lithium Battery Charging & Discharging Tester

CM-CF series adopts intelligent charging & discharging integrated control technology, which is mainly applied to the charging&discharging test of low-voltage battery packs to regulate the voltage or SOC of the module to reach the same standard range, thus avoiding the inconsistency in voltage and capacity due to replacing the battery module, and the unreasonable decline in the range of new energy vehicles.

Parameters

Model Name CM-CF 6050 CM-CF 60100
Voltage range DC 0-60V
Current range 0~50A (3kW) 0~100A (6kW)
Working modes Discharge, charge, cycle activation 
Display 7 inch LCD touch screen,1024×800 resolution
Group End Voltage Accuracy +0.5%FS+0.1V, Resolution 0.1V (Module) 
Individual voltage accuracy (optional) 0~5V@±0.2%FS±5mV, Resolution 0.001V (Cell) 
Current accuracy ±1%@100A, Resolution 0.1A
Communication interface RS485/USB
Environment Temperature:-10℃~65℃;Humidity:0~90%.   Altitude <4000 meters
Heat dissipation Air cooling
Size 485*230*400
Weight(kg) 21 23

What is a lithium battery charging and discharging tester?
A lithium battery charging and discharging tester is used to evaluate battery capacity, performance, and lifecycle through controlled charge and discharge cycles, widely used in EV and energy storage systems.
A battery tester measures basic parameters, while a battery cycler performs full charge-discharge cycles to analyze battery lifespan and performance in detail.
